The Hidden Cost of Delay: Understanding Lead Decay in Forklift Rentals

The Hidden Cost of Delay: Understanding Lead Decay in Forklift Rentals

In the competitive forklift rental market, where timely responses can make or break a deal, the phenomenon of "lead decay" poses a significant, yet often overlooked, challenge. Lead decay refers to the rapid decrease in the likelihood of converting a lead into a rental as time passes between the initial inquiry and the company's response. Responding within 5 minutes increases the qualification likelihood by 21x compared to waiting 30 minutes, highlighting the critical nature of prompt engagement source.

The forklift rental industry, projected to grow at a 5.7% CAGR with the global construction equipment rental market reaching $189.4 billion by 2030, is not immune to this issue source. The average B2B response time of 42 hours is starkly at odds with the 5-minute benchmark for optimal lead qualification, leaving a substantial gap for improvement source.

  • First Responder Advantage: 78% of customers purchase from the first company to respond, emphasizing the need for immediate engagement source.
  • Exponential Decline: The likelihood of qualifying a lead drops 391% if the response is delayed by just one minute, underscoring the time-sensitive nature of inquiries source.
  • Missed Opportunities: Over 30% of leads are never contacted, often due to slow response times, resulting in lost rental opportunities source.

From Delay to Immediate Action: Implementation Strategies for Forklift Rentals

The moment a forklift rental inquiry lands in your inbox, a clock starts ticking—not just for you, but for your competitors. Research shows that responding within five minutes makes prospects 21x more likely to qualify, yet the average B2B company waits 42 hours to reply. The first responder advantage is undeniable: 78% of customers buy from the first company to respond. For field-heavy industries like forklift rentals, where timing and availability drive decisions, every second counts. The gap between a slow response and an instant one isn’t just a missed lead—it’s a lost sale to someone who moved faster.

To close this response-time chasm, your business needs a system that acts the minute a lead appears, not when someone remembers to check their email. Start by unifying your engagement channels. Prospects in the equipment rental industry expect immediate answers, whether they’re browsing your website at 2 a.m. or calling after hours. An AI assistant that answers questions instantly on webchat, captures leads via voice calls, and follows up across SMS, email, and forms ensures no inquiry slips through the cracks. These tools don’t just respond faster—they keep your business top of mind by staying available 24/7, a critical advantage when 30% of leads are never contacted due to slow follow-ups.

Automation is the backbone of speed. A visual lead pipeline that tags new inquiries, triggers instant personalized emails, and escalates high-intent prospects to your team in real time prevents human error and delay. For example, a forklift rental company using this system could auto-assign urgent leads (like same-day availability requests) to the closest manager, cutting response times from hours to minutes.
